Fishing in Ontario: Which Season is Best?

We are always asked, "When is the best time of the year to plan a fly-in fishing trip?" As with most places in Ontario and across Canada, the answer is, anytime from ice-out in May to the freeze-up in late October. The fishing is always good in our remote fly-in outpost lakes, although fishing techniques may vary with the time of year. When planning a fishing trip with your family, you may find that July and August are the most suitable months because of the weather and the water temperature for swimming.

Catch and Release Fishing

Catch and Release Fishing

Nestor Falls Fly-In was one of the first Outposts operations in northern Ontario to implement a catch and release policy as not to overstress the fishery. That visionary policy has served our operation well throughout the years as we continue to enjoy world-class fishing and significant repeat business from our guests. Every year the average size of the fish goes up as well as the numbers of fish caught. What the catch and release means is that you may keep your conservation limit of fish under the legal size limit to eat while you are at the lake but you may not take home any fish or any trophies from the our lakes.
